KOBAYASHI Keiichi
KOBAYASHI Keiichi
なるほど・・・(´Д`) では 64bit 版を公式配布すること自体はおそらく初めてのはずで、インパクトはあると考えることにします。64bit 対応以外に次回リリースで入れたい機能ってありますか?>all
アンケート良いですね。次リリースバージョンの初回起動時だけアンケート促すダイアログとか入れたいなーと思いました(うざいですかね。一度起動だけなら良いかな、と)。 あと、ヘルプメニューから「GitHub Issues」「アンケート」に直接飛べるリンク張りたいな、と思っています。
アンケートはインストーラから起動が良さそうですね
機能については PR に上がってきたものがあればガンガン吸収したいです。 自分のほうでもひとつ実装したい機能があるので近いうちに上げようかと。 > 自動更新 新しいバージョンのリリースを自動検知してステータスバーに表示するくらいが無難かな、と思いました。自動更新って「実装が大変そう」かつ「自動更新されたくないユーザも多そう」なので。
SakuraDown って誰がメンテしているのかって誰か分かりますか。 ちょろっと見た感じ、これ VB 製ですね。
Twitterハッシュタグ良いと思います。活発に使われるのであればTwitterハッシュタグの検索結果をトップページに埋め込むと良いかも。 標準UTF-8化、対応したいです。 ストアは……UWP形式にしないと配布できないという認識でしたがどうでしたっけ……。 設定画面もそろそろ整理したいですね。ツリーにするのに加えて検索ボックスを付けられるとかなり利便性上がると思います。
無題ドキュメントがどこのディレクトリを Current Directory にしているかというのはユーザ目線では分かりようが無いので、該当ディレクトリは消せるようになっていてほしいですね・・・ > ドキュメントプロセスのカレントディレクトリは、マクロの実行フォルダであったり、保存する際の初期フォルダであったりという形で使用されているかと思います。どのドキュメントプロセスから新規作成したファイルであるかは無視してほしくありません。テキストファイルだからと常にマイドキュメントに保存しようとするエディタは馬鹿です。 「カレントディレクトリ」以外の仕組みでディレクトリ情報をどこかに保持しておけば良いのでは、と思います。
なるほど。カレントディレクトリをユーザに意識させるような仕様が既にあるんですね。でもこの仕様自体があまりイケてないですね。意識させるならせめてそれを表示させる等が必要で、ユーザの脳内メモリにそれを任せるのはさすがに解せぬという感じです。 ただ、カレントディレクトリ相当の何かしらはたしかにあったほうが便利であることにも同意です。何かしら良い案を考えます (「カレントフォルダ」という言い回しと実装を変えれば良いだけな気がしますが良い言い回しがすぐには思いつきませんね)
「カレントフォルダ」「カレントディレクトリ」という言い回しがプログラマチックすぎるので、「作業フォルダ」と言われたら一般ユーザの一部もたしかに理解してくれそうな概念ですね。 タイトルバーに現在の作業フォルダを表示する、みたいなことをしていれば、ユーザとしては、「あぁこのフォルダが消せないのはあの無題のサクラエディタが作業フォルダを掴んでいるのか」と理解して対応しやすくはなると思いました。 もしくは「作業フォルダ」といいつつ、実際の実装ではエディタ起動時の current directory をどこかに保管はした上で、current directory は別の場所(たとえば sakura.exe の場所等)に変更してしまうようなことをしてしまえばディレクトリ消せない問題も回避できます。 仮に作業フォルダへ保存するつもりが保存時にはそのフォルダが存在しなくなっていた場合、その親フォルダ、さらにそれも存在しなかったらさらにその親フォルダ、ぜんぶ存在しなかったら何かしらデフォルトのフォルダ(例えばマイドキュメントとか)を保存ダイアログの初期ディレクトリとして設定してあげるのか親切かなと思いました。
Thanks for your report. Only VS2017 is requird for this project. But when I checked the proejct just now, some compile errors occured. The cause is that depending nuget boost...